Introduction

When it comes to safeguarding your property, a panoramic security camera is an essential tool. These advanced cameras provide a 180 to 360-degree view, ensuring that no corner is left unmonitored. With the ability to cover expansive areas, panoramic security cameras are perfect for both residential and commercial settings. They help to deter potential intruders and provide peace of mind to property owners.

Here are some key features and benefits of panoramic security cameras:
  • Wide Coverage: Capture more area with fewer cameras, reducing installation costs.
  • High Resolution: Enjoy clear and detailed images, making it easier to identify individuals or events.
  • Remote Access: Monitor your property in real-time from anywhere using your smartphone or computer.
  • Motion Detection: Receive alerts when movement is detected, allowing for quick responses to potential threats.
  • Night Vision: Many models come equipped with infrared capabilities for effective monitoring in low-light conditions.

FAQs

How can I choose the best panoramic security camera for my needs?

Consider factors such as resolution, field of view, night vision capabilities, and whether you need remote access features. Assess the specific areas you want to monitor to determine the best fit.

What are the key features to look for when selecting a panoramic security camera?

Look for high resolution, wide-angle lenses, motion detection, night vision, and ease of installation. Additionally, check for compatibility with smart home systems.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ing panoramic security cameras?

Common mistakes include underestimating the required resolution, neglecting to check for night vision, and overlooking the importance of a reliable power source.

Can I install a panoramic security camera myself?

Yes, many panoramic security cameras are designed for easy DIY installation. However, for complex setups or hard-to-reach locations, professional installation may be advisable.

How do panoramic security cameras compare to traditional security cameras?

Panoramic security cameras offer a wider field of view, allowing for comprehensive coverage with fewer units, while traditional cameras may require multiple units to cover the same area.
